Jim Engster moderates a debate at the Baton Rouge Press Club on October 12, 2020, between three of the candidates for United States Senate: Shreveport Mayor Adrian Perkins (D); Baton Rouge businessman Antoine Pierce (D); and New Orleans teacher Peter Wenstrup (D). The incumbent, United States Senator Bill Cassidy (R), declined his invitation to attend. The debate begins with each candidate’s opening statement. Members of the press then ask the candidates questions on the following topics: Cassidy’s support of the 2017 tax cuts; Cassidy’s support for President Donald Trump; how long they have been a Democrat and whether they would consider switching parties; who they voted for in the 2019 gubernatorial election; whether they would vote to confirm Amy Coney Barrett as a Supreme Court Justice; their stance on defunding the police; and Cassidy’s vote to repeal the Affordable Care Act. The candidates then ask each other questions. The debate ends with each candidate’s closing statement.
